Historical context
Plate 170 of Wada's 348 anchors Rosolanc Purple, Orange Yellow and Red Violet in the pink family — a 3-colour grouping with a refined character, recorded in Sanzo Wada's 1933 Dictionary of Color Combinations (six volumes; Seigensha Art Publishing 2010 reprint), and in the public domain by age. Its strongest pairing — Orange Yellow on Red Violet — reaches a contrast ratio of 6.11:1, meeting the WCAG AA bar for body text, so it holds up for text-on-colour layouts as well as decorative use.
